本文在总结了大量实验基础上,讨论了如何根据金属显微组织的特点及分析目的去正确地选择探针线扫描分析的操作条件,分析了在CRT上线扫描分布曲线与金属显微组织的浓度分布的对应关系,并讨论了实际应用。操作条件主要指加速电压、探针电流、放大器增益、脉冲高度分析器的阀电平和窗口值、以及计数率器量程。其中加速电压的选择已有现成的数据可供参考,本文没予讨论。
